Schiff base supported MCM-41 catalyzed the Knoevenagel condensation in water

By employing a MCM-41/Schiff base as catalyst, high yield Knoevenagel condensation reactions of malononitrile with aromatic aldehydes were realized. The reaction afforded the corresponding products in excellent yields (up to 99%) in water. Moreover, the catalyst was also found to exhibit excellent recyclability (up to 10 times) without loss of efficiency.
